Ex-pupil wins £145,000 payout over drug use at top boarding school

A TEENAGER left with PTSD after she was given drugs by sixth-form boys at a boarding school has won £145,000 in compensation.

Challenge...ex-pupil Ms Pedraves at court
Inune Pedrayes was only 14 and had just joined £34,000-a-year Buckswood School near Hastings when she was provided with mephedrone-laced vape liquid.
She told a High Court judge she spent a Friday to Sunday vaping the Class B drug and drinking alcohol with others. The binge put her in hospital after she suffered an extended “psychotic outbreak” including hallucinations, anxiety and tearfulness.
Her parents were not told and the breakdown continued for weeks until she left the school to return to her native Spain, where she received anti-psychotic medication.
She sued and, now 20, won a payout after Judge Geraint Webb KC found staff “negligent” in failing to tell her parents. The East Sussex school led them to believe the hospital trip was for an unrelated infection.
